Understanding Bifold Doors and Their Tracks

Bifold doors consist of 2 or more panels that fold versus one another when opened. The movement is helped with by a track system at the top and bottom, which assists guide the panels smoothly. The tracks are pivotal for the effortless operation of the doors-- when they end up being damaged or misaligned, the functionality of the entire door system may be compromised.

Indications You Need to Replace Bifold Door Tracks

Before swapping out tracks, it's crucial to determine indications that indicate replacement is needed. House owners ought to be alert for the following signs:

  1. Difficulty Opening or Closing: If the bifold doors stick or require excessive force to operate, it might be time for a replacement.
  2. Noticeable Damage: Warping, flexing, or rust can all suggest it's time for new tracks.
  3. Misalignment: If the panels do not align properly when closed, this might be a sign that the track has moved or is harmed.
  4. Noisy Operation: Grinding or scraping noises when operating the doors may show a problem with the track.

Steps to Replace Bifold Door Tracks

Replacing bifold door tracks might seem overwhelming, however the job can be achieved with the right tools and steps. Below is a detailed guide to help with the replacement procedure.

Tools and Materials Needed

  • Replacement bifold door tracks (guarantee they work with your door design)
  • Screwdriver (flathead and Phillips)
  • Drill (if required)
  • Level
  • Measuring tape
  • Security safety glasses
  • Cleaning products (to clear the track location)

Step-by-Step Replacement Process

Remove the Bifold Doors:

  • Start by carefully getting rid of the bifold doors by raising them from the track and pulling them free.
  • Set them aside carefully to avoid damage.

Examine the Existing Track:

  • Inspect the old track for any screws or fasteners, and eliminate them using your screwdriver.

Cleaning:

  • Thoroughly clean the area where the old track was installed. Get rid of any debris, dust, or dirt to make sure a smooth setup of the new track.

Set Up the New Track:

  • Position the new track in location. Guarantee it's lined up correctly and use a level to validate it's straight.
  • Protect the track utilizing the required screws, guaranteeing it is firmly secured.

Rehang the Bifold Doors:

  • With the brand-new track in place, thoroughly rehang the bifold doors by inserting the leading and bottom pivots into the new track.
  • Check the operation of the doors to ensure smooth movement.

Final Adjustments:

  • Some bifold door systems come with adjustable hinges. Make any needed modifications to guarantee the panels line up properly.

Maintenance Tips for Bifold Door Tracks

To lengthen the life of your bifold door tracks, consider the following maintenance tips:

  1. Regular Cleaning: Keep the tracks without debris to allow smooth operation.
  2. Lubrication: Apply a silicone-based lubricant to the track and rollers occasionally to reduce friction.
  3. Examine for Wear: Regularly check the tracks for any visible wear and attend to any problems immediately.
  4. Avoid Overloading: Ensure not to hang items from the doors as this can strain the tracks and mechanisms.

Frequently Asked Questions about Bifold Door Replacement Tracks

Q1: How do I know what size track to buy for my bifold doors?

A: Measure the width of your existing track and the height from the top of the door opening to the floor. This will help identify the appropriate size required for replacement.

Q2: Can I replace bifold door tracks myself?

A: Yes, with the right tools and guidelines, the majority of house owners can replace bifold door tracks themselves. Nevertheless, if you feel not sure, hiring a professional is suggested.

Q3: How much does it generally cost to replace bifold door tracks?

A: Costs can vary extensively depending upon your area, the kind of track, and labor charges if you select professional assistance. Usually, tracks themselves can range from ₤ 20-₤ 100, with setup costs potentially adding an additional ₤ 100-₤ 300.

Q4: Is it required to replace both the leading and bottom tracks?

A: It's not always obligatory, but if one track is worn out, there's a great chance the other may be also. Check both and replace them if essential for optimal performance.
